MADRID/SACRAMENTO. Market players in Spain are highly satisfied with last year’s performance. The prices for US almond preparations have shifted notably. California Almonds is set to issue the position report for December on 10 January.

Optimistic market in Spain

Market players in Spain have reaped large profits in 2019. Although spot market prices have largely flatlined over the last few weeks with only nominal changes observed in Albacate, Reus and Murcia, it should be noted that prices have risen sharply since last year. Most notably, organic almonds are trading EUR 2.00 per kg higher than one year ago and were last quoted in Murcia at EUR 8.68 per kg. The prices for Largueta, Valencia and Marcona almonds have also risen by more than EUR 1.00 per kg since last year.
